A massive luxury vessel parked in Marina del Rey all week has triggered intense curiosity across social media. The superyacht pulled into the Los Angeles harbor a few days ago, shrouded in secrecy. Harbor watchers immediately noticed that the vessel’s identifying nameplate had been concealed upon arrival, an uncommon move that quickly caught the attention of local boaters. However, locals and internet investigators identified the high-profile owner as Harry Potter creator J.K. Rowling.

The California Post noted (via the New York Post) that the 290-foot mega-craft belongs to the 61-year-old British author. Another commenter recalled that the same yacht stopped at the marina last May, where the crew similarly masked the moniker and turned off its AIS tracking signal due to public backlash surrounding Rowling’s activism. Despite efforts by the crew to mask the vessel’s identity, harbor residents considered her arrival an open secret, with one observer calling it the worst-kept secret in the entire marina. The ship’s arrival quickly gained traction after being documented by the boating Instagram account twogirls.oneboat. Comment sections on Reddit and Instagram lit up with details from marina regulars. One social media commenter pointed out that local harbor captains recognised the vessel as Rowling’s yacht, named Samsara, noting that the nameplate gets covered to avoid drawing organised demonstrations. Moreover, maritime data from Marine Traffic verifies the boat’s location in Marina del Rey.

What is inside JK Rowling’s $150 million mega-vessel

Constructed in 2015 by custom shipyard Oceanco, the yacht began its journey as Infinity under its first owner, Harbor Freight Tools chief executive Eric Smidt. Australian billionaire Brett Blundy acquired the vessel in 2022 before selling it to Rowling in 2023, who rechristened the vessel Samsara. Estimated to be worth roughly $150 million, the yacht houses 26 crew members and accommodates more than 12 guests. The yacht has previously drawn headlines with Rowling igniting backlash from the deck of Samsara in 2025 after posting a cigar-smoking photo.

Its onboard amenities include a private cinema, a tranquil beach club and a circular outdoor pool, according to SuperYachtFan.com.
